From ec23c98518e28432b684fab4f43817f94dbecfb7 Mon Sep 17 00:00:00 2001 From: Natalia Portillo Date: Thu, 9 Oct 2025 22:52:10 +0100 Subject: [PATCH] Add test for HiFD image in AaruFormat V1. --- tests/CMakeLists.txt | 1 + tests/data/hifd_v1.aif | Bin 0 -> 1427 bytes tests/open_image.cpp | 58 +++++++++++++++++++++++++++++++++++++++++ 3 files changed, 59 insertions(+) create mode 100755 tests/data/hifd_v1.aif diff --git a/tests/CMakeLists.txt b/tests/CMakeLists.txt index 3194ae2..ed70cf4 100644 --- a/tests/CMakeLists.txt +++ b/tests/CMakeLists.txt @@ -33,6 +33,7 @@ file(COPY ${CMAKE_CURRENT_SOURCE_DIR}/data/floptical_v1.aif DESTINATION ${CMAKE_ file(COPY ${CMAKE_CURRENT_SOURCE_DIR}/data/floptical.aif DESTINATION ${CMAKE_CURRENT_BINARY_DIR}/data/) file(COPY ${CMAKE_CURRENT_SOURCE_DIR}/data/gigamo_v1.aif DESTINATION ${CMAKE_CURRENT_BINARY_DIR}/data/) file(COPY ${CMAKE_CURRENT_SOURCE_DIR}/data/gigamo.aif DESTINATION ${CMAKE_CURRENT_BINARY_DIR}/data/) +file(COPY ${CMAKE_CURRENT_SOURCE_DIR}/data/hifd_v1.aif DESTINATION ${CMAKE_CURRENT_BINARY_DIR}/data/) # Test executable (all unit tests) add_executable(tests_run crc64.cpp spamsum.cpp crc32.c crc32.h flac.cpp lzma.cpp sha256.cpp md5.cpp sha1.cpp open_image.cpp) diff --git a/tests/data/hifd_v1.aif b/tests/data/hifd_v1.aif new file mode 100755 index 0000000000000000000000000000000000000000..4bd9a79550ca83dbbfc430bf3674dc0b9ea1bb03 GIT binary patch literal 1427 zcmZ>C3<`A%@(pohNMtBtC}kiQFfy<*OlM+X@MVRV5S3e2=^b{Baq7oOD?zl2laDte z10w?i69dCHMg|534hDt?4^x&OQsMr?@_p?UfxXIku?!&T(tbXcOKTsU`J8`o+M|1` zOCyb<6c2i3xpIr%ZscPuswh&uYQnvC+tN)}B{%Jji>`Xbn$*E<@=0p>m)SQfr1iO3 z0y!I&?K>P{8$4mr@;_hKuiLB^@Rfl@S+>???&2p7OG0%1E7w=Qc&4~gl#fMmTdGY$ zaoU4F8uL&8SyXJ8urqJhtO-mj-uSOydR4Yv<7LR4i%0Kv_p1MV=J|BilhAo{j89Aj6CuHU_KJu(Q zdx?MTD~`&BS^-yycUJk|&Wa!0yoqVAg-Eto+UggX_TM(n&|Rc{CFx_3adh4rd*g?B zQ=GgO-)c!R{Bh+>!=H<%_uOiCn(gs0@Kv*_uygc+3;*T1&Kdr<&^nS^;KVEU}bjQ5i351;zBU~N!=%yRDYX6NSZjf?)VA-C5sY|6S) znyArJD0@7UAwbH zw#Qw{Ci3XSU#{idtUPl}^nT2WH+U47^Yw_q?#g|PFfgz&Fo04OL$JSJB!fq$n+t=X zk(mjDV`5P$gQ=c@o~5Opk)@>}gHL8&X$8mtFkTGS$H3s?5~2l4l{`zJ0&+}Xc?Jbm z12Ch#WQ|et$3q}nzVnOOiflJsl&N)PGX0s)))(Fo@IBe08IM=a zcIMfz%_a!9TuE zG&5vfy5U{^!2(}*o{JL&SFKHu-F0rGx